They make it easy. Every month, they update their new arrivals list online, broken up into Blurays, CDs, etc. Sift through it, place your holds, wait for the emails to come. I love that shite. You can even make requests when they don't have an item. It's a nice perk from my property taxes.

BTW, I haven't used it for a while, but there is/was a service called Freegal, which last I checked, gave you 10 free MP3 downloads a week. The Sony library was part of it, and I got several full Candyrat albums off it. (Candyrat publishes contemporary solo guitarists. Great stuff.)
